3. Developing a Professional Portfolio
A well-curated portfolio is a vital tool in presenting your skills and versatility to potential clients and agencies. Invest in high-quality photographs that showcase your modeling abilities and represent the type of work you aspire to do. Include a diverse range of images that display your versatility and ability to adapt to different styles and concepts. Remember to update your portfolio regularly as your skills and experience progress.

5. Navigating the Agency Pathway
A reputable modeling agency can significantly enhance your modeling career. Research and approach agencies that align with your goals and aspirations. Prepare a professional package that includes your portfolio, composite card, and relevant contact information. Remember, rejection is a part of the process, so don't be disheartened by a few setbacks. Take constructive criticism positively and continue to hone your skills.

Q1: How do I find the right modeling agency for me?
A1: Research modeling agencies that align with your goals, attend open calls, and seek recommendations from industry professionals to find the right fit.
Q2: How can I improve my posing abilities?
A2: Practice posing in front of a mirror, study successful models' poses, and work with photographers who can give you guidance and feedback.
Q3: Can I pursue a modeling career if I don't fit the traditional beauty standards?
A3: Absolutely! The modeling industry is evolving, and diversity is celebrated. Embrace your unique qualities as they can be a strength in attracting clients looking for fresh and diverse faces.
Q4: How often should I update my portfolio?
A4: Aim to update your portfolio at least once every six months to showcase your growth, new experiences, and evolving style.
